Dr. Ahmed Rashwan, PT, DPT
Physical Therapist
 
Dr. Rashwan has received his doctoral level degree in Physical Therapy from the University of St. Augustine for Health Sciences. His manual therapy training from Dr. Stanley V. Paris includes:
  • Physical Therapy Manipulation of the spine, neck and sacroiliac joints
  • Evaluation and treatment of orthopedic injuries
  • Evaluation and treatment of sports injuries
  • Sport-specific training and rehabilitation
  • Post-surgical rehabilitation
  • Joint mobilization

Laurin K. Stocker, MS OTR/L
Occupational Therapist

Laurin is a highly experienced therapist who has practiced with patients who are suffering from hand or upper extremity disorders since 1997. She has experience in diagnosis ranging from osteoarthritis (O/A), rheumatoid arthritis (R/A), lateral and medial epicondylitis, wrist (sprain, strains, fractures, internal and external fixatures and tendonitis), S/P flexor and extensor tendon repairs, PIP, MP DIP joint fractures, S/P CVA, rotator cuff injuries and repairs, shoulder impingement and tendonitis, RSD (complex regional pain syndrome), and customized splints for fractures and deformities.

Laurin earned her BA in Social Relations with a minor in Psychology from Lehigh University and her Masters of Science in Occupational Therapy from Nova University. She has been the Director of Occupational Therapy at Innova Health since 2000 and continues with Advanced Fitness & Therapy.

Fitness Facility Director/Exercise Physiologist

Dan is a native of North Dakota and has been associated with the Athletic Republic® Network since 1994. Dan received his undergraduate degree in Athletic Training from North Dakota State University in 2000. He is a Certified Athletic Trainer (ATC) with licensure in the state of Florida, along with being a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ist (CSCS). Dan earned his masters degree in exercise physiology (MS) from the University of Kentucky in 2002. While working in the University of Kentucky (UK) Athletics Department as a graduate assistant (GA), Dan worked as a strength and conditioning coach training the tennis and baseball teams, while assisting with the football and swimming teams. He is an active member of the American College of Sports Medicine (ACSM), the National Strength and Conditioning Association (NSCA), and the National Athletic Trainers Association (NATA).
